I have to admit IMO it’s indeed not so beginner-friendly (this is Tree of Restrictions after all), but just be patient with the inconvenience and focus on leveling.

Install Addon Manager https://github.com/Excrulon/Tree-of-Savior-Addon-Manager and install the BetterQuest addon. Follow the quest line from top to bottom per map (make sure you check “Show eligible quests”). Complete monster kill counts as well if you can as they’re a good source of additional exp cards and more farmed silver helps.

To supplement that, here’s a comprehensive leveling guide as well: https://www.reddit.com/r/treeofsavior/comments/45xa7j/leveling_guide_for_ktos/

Depending on your class/build, you should have enough silver to buy a token at around lv.75-130 at most. Don’t go into buying equipments first as you’ll get plenty of them from monster drops and quest rewards.

You’ll only want to start investing in equipments at around lv.170.
